First Amendment rights
The First Amendment to the United States Constitution guarantees the right to freedom of speech, which includes the right to criticize public figures. This means that memes about Trump shooting are protected by the First Amendment, even if they are critical of the president.
The First Amendment is an important part of American democracy. It allows people to express their opinions freely, even if those opinions are unpopular or offensive. Memes about Trump shooting are a form of political speech, and they are therefore protected by the First Amendment.
However, the First Amendment does not protect speech that is likely to incite imminent lawless action. This means that memes about Trump shooting that are intended to incite violence could be considered a crime.
It is important to remember that the First Amendment is not absolute. There are some limits to what people can say or do in the name of free speech. However, memes about Trump shooting are generally protected by the First Amendment, even if they are critical of the president.
